The charge nurse informs a staff nurse that it is her turn to float to another unit. Which response by the staff nurse is aggressive?
"I will float, but you'll be sorry. You cannot handle emergencies without me."
"I will not survive on the other unit. The staff are always too busy to help me."
"I had such a bad experience last time. Please send another nurse instead of me."
"I will miss working with you today, but I understand that it is my turn to float."
The Correct Answer is A
A. This statement is aggressive and threatening.
B. This statement expresses concern but is not aggressive.
C. This statement is a request for reconsideration based on past experience but is not aggressive.
D. This statement shows understanding and willingness to follow the schedule, demonstrating assertiveness.
